The Great Pyramid of Giza is the oldest and largest of the three pyramids. It is the oldest of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. It is believed the pyramid was built as a tomb for fourth dynasty Egyptian Pharaoh Khufu. It was constructed over a 20-year period concluding around 2560 BC.

 The Hanging Gardens of Babylon, were in Iraq.  They were built by the Babylonian king Nebuchadnezzar II.  The gardens were destroyed by several earthquakes.

The Statue of Zeus at Olympia was made by the Greek sculptor Phidias. It was erected in the Temple of Zeus, Olympia, Greece. The seated statue, 12 meters tall, occupied the whole width of the aisle of the temple. It is believed that the statute was destroyed in a great fire. The Temple of Artemis is also known as the Temple of Diana. It was dedicated to a goddess (in present-day Turkey). Only foundations and sculptural fragments of the temple remain. The Colossus of Rhodes was a statue of the Greek god Helios. It was erected in the Greek island of Rhodes by Chares of Lindos. Mausoleum of Halicarnassus The Mausoleum at Halicarnassus was a Tomb in present Turkey The structure was designed by the Greek architects Satyros and Pythis. It stood approximately 148 ft in height, and each of the four sides was adorned with sculptural reliefs. Chichén Itzá, the most famous Mayan temple city. It served as the political and economic center of the Mayan civilization. The pyramid itself was the last, and the greatest, of all Mayan temples.

This immense mausoleum was built on the orders of Shah Jahan, the fifth Muslim Mogul emperor, to honor the memory of his beloved late wife. Built out of white marble and standing in formally laid-out walled gardens. The Taj Mahal is regarded as the most perfect jewel of Muslim art in India. This statue of Jesus stands some 38 meters tall, overlooking Rio de Janeiro. Designed by Brazilian Heitor da Silva Costa and created by French sculptor Paul Landowski. The Roman Colosseum ( A.D.) Rome, Italy This great amphitheater in the centre of Rome was built to give favors to successful legionnaires and to celebrate the glory of the Roman Empire. Today, through films and history books, we are more aware of the cruel fights and games that took place in this arena, all for the joy of the spectators. The Great Wall of China was built to link existing fortifications into a united defense system. It is the largest man-made monument ever to have been built. It is disputed that it is the only one visible from space.

Petra is on the edge of the Arabian Desert. Petra was the glittering capital of the Nabataean empire of King Aretas IV (9 B.C. to 40 A.D.)
